Predicting Efficacy of Virtual Reality-Based Stabilization for Individuals With Posttraumatic Stress Symptoms: A

Summary
Virtual reality-based stabilization (VRS) effectively reduced posttraumatic stress symptoms (PTSS) and improved mental health in COVID-19 survivors and healthcare workers. Machine learning models accurately predicted intervention effectiveness, enabling personalized mental health support.
Area of Science:
- Mental Health
- Psychological Interventions
- Virtual Reality Applications
Background:
- Respiratory infectious diseases, like COVID-19, caused significant mental health challenges globally.
- There is a critical need for proactive psychological interventions to prepare for future pandemics.
- Virtual reality-based stabilization (VRS) was developed to mitigate posttraumatic stress symptoms (PTSS) and related comorbidities.
Purpose of the Study:
- To evaluate the effectiveness of VRS in COVID-19 survivors and healthcare workers.
- To predict the impact of VRS on PTSS and depression using machine learning.
- To identify factors influencing VRS effectiveness for personalized interventions.
Main Methods:
- A study involving 43 COVID-19 survivors and healthcare workers assessed VRS effectiveness over five sessions.
- Pre- and post-intervention psychological assessments measured PTSS, depression, anxiety, COVID-related fear, posttraumatic growth, and quality of life.
- A machine learning model predicted changes in PTSS and depression using baseline assessments and heart rate variability.
Main Results:
- VRS significantly improved all measured psychological outcomes post-intervention.
- The machine learning model showed good predictive accuracy (R2=0.414-0.723) for PTSS and depression changes.
- Higher baseline PTSS, elevated heart rate variability, and younger age correlated with greater improvement.
Conclusions:
- VRS is an effective intervention for PTSS and associated mental health conditions.
- Integrating clinical and demographic data enhances prediction models for personalized mental healthcare.
- VRS offers a promising approach for psychological support during and after pandemics.
